What are ASIC mining Tokens?

 Today, Bitcoin is exclusively mined into existence by physical mining equipment known as Application Specific Integrated Circuits (ASIC Miners). Since these are only available to a select number of people, mining Bitcoin is not feasible for the everyday  person!  PulseBitcoin solves this by exclusively using software to perform its mining operation by using Application Specific Internet Currency Tokens (ASIC Tokens). This allows  anyone anywhere in the world to mine the next generation Bitcoin and LiteCoin. No hardware  required! 

How To Mine with ASIC

Once you have selected one of the two networks you would like to participate in mining (Ethereum or PulseChain) click the 'Buy  Tokens' on the main page and acquire the ASIC. Once you have them select dual or single mining, once there you can deposit your ASIC mining tokens into the smart contract for a 30 day period and click start miner. Come back in 30 days to end your miner where your ASIC will be returned to your wallet along with your PulseLiteCoin and or PulseBitcoin reward, you can then repeat the process. Each time you mine 0.025% of your ASIC is burnt making the tokens deflationary. Please note there is a 60 day window to end your miner after the 30 days otherwise penalties incur.
